  • Abig malbec with little tannin. The best Malbec I have tasted in recent years. The price point is high compared to South Americans the taste is full bodied. Gorgeous color. and ripe with fruit, tastes of plum earth and maybe a hint of raisin. Highest recommendation. In a blind tasting with five others, 9 out of ten people in our group selected this as the best.
